Explore the second lecture on Learning from Dependent Data, delivered by Prateek Jain as part of the Discussion Meeting on Data Science: Probabilistic and Optimization Methods. Delve into advanced concepts and techniques for analyzing interconnected datasets, building upon the foundations established in the previous session. Gain insights into the challenges and methodologies associated with extracting meaningful information from complex, interdependent data structures. Enhance your understanding of cutting-edge approaches in data science, particularly focusing on probabilistic and optimization methods applied to dependent data scenarios.
